In the Indonesia sandstone market, the import trend experienced a notable decline from 2023 to 2024, with a growth rate of -30.77%. Despite this, the compound annual growth rate (CAGR) for the period 2020-2024 stood at a robust 47.0%. This decline in import momentum could be attributed to shifts in demand dynamics or changes in trade policies impacting market stability.

The Indonesia Sandstone market displays promising potential as the construction and interior design sectors seek high-quality and aesthetically appealing materials. Sandstone, with its durability and natural beauty, is gaining traction for applications such as paving, cladding, and sculptures. The country`s diverse range of sandstone varieties positions it well to cater to both local and global demand, contributing to the growth of the market.
The Indonesia Sandstone market is witnessing growth driven by several factors. Firstly, the construction industry in Indonesia is booming, with numerous infrastructure projects and real estate developments. Sandstone, with its durability and aesthetic appeal, is in high demand as a construction material, especially for facades, flooring, and landscaping. Additionally, the tourism sector is thriving, and sandstone`s use in historical and cultural site preservation and restoration is increasing. Moreover, the export market for Indonesia sandstone has expanded due to its quality and competitive pricing, contributing to the market`s growth. Furthermore, the government`s initiatives to promote the use of locally sourced materials have bolstered the domestic demand for sandstone.
The Indonesia Sandstone Market faces a range of challenges, primarily driven by market dynamics and environmental concerns. One of the key challenges is the cyclic nature of the construction industry, which significantly impacts the demand for sandstone. Economic downturns and reduced construction activities can lead to decreased demand and pricing pressures. Environmental regulations and concerns related to quarrying practices and habitat disruption require sandstone producers to adopt sustainable and responsible extraction methods. Moreover, competition from alternative building materials like concrete and synthetic stones presents a challenge in maintaining market share. Ensuring consistent quality and meeting design and architectural specifications are also vital challenges in this market.
The COVID-19 pandemic led to a slowdown in the construction industry, impacting the demand for sandstone. Many construction projects were delayed or put on hold, affecting the market.
Key players in the Indonesia Sandstone market include local quarrying and construction companies, such as Jaya Ancol, Sentra Batu Alam, and Putra Rajawali Kencana. These companies are involved in the extraction and distribution of sandstone for construction and decorative purposes.
